My Students
"Excuses are the nails that built the house of failure." Our wrestlers understand and live by this quote. This group of exceptional young athletes is constantly rising above challenges in order to become leaders in their sport and in the classroom.
The wrestling team is a tight knit group of students that encourage and support each other through all obstacles.
Each year the wrestlers work hard to fundraise in order to financially support their season. Things like uniforms, head gear and other training equipment is earned through hours of hard work. The wrestlers do this because they share a love and passion for their sport. They are the athletes that are the first to arrive at the school in the mornings and they are the last to leave in the afternoons. They work tirelessly because they want to rise above the rest.
My Project
The students need a safe surface to be able to conduct their wrestling practices and matches. The new mat will provide a wonderful opportunity for both existing student athletes and new team members to practice and compete. The new mat will be the site of all home matches, in addition to providing a place for tournaments and special events. Wrestlers will be able to take their craft to the next level. Whether it is a "two on one" or an "arm drag" our student athletes will use this new mat to push themselves further and reach new levels of excellence!
Donations to this project will help elevate a group of young athletes and enable them to become successful.
Wrestling teaches youth the importance of work ethic, self discipline and accountability. It also teaches them to stand up in the face of adversity. The wrestlers work extremely hard every year and deserve a new mat to provide a safe space for learning these important lessons that they will carry with them throughout the rest of their lives.
